10 Euros UEFA Euros 2016 - Heading the Ball
2016 yearGold plated silver (.925) (plated ball) | 22.7 g | 37 mm |
Issuer | France |
---|---|
Period | Fifth Republic (1958-date) |
Type | Non-circulating coin |
Year | 2016 |
Value | 10 Euros 10 EUR = USD 11 |
Currency | Euro (2002-date) |
Composition | Gold plated silver (.925) (plated ball) |
Weight | 22.7 g |
Diameter | 37 mm |
Thickness | 2.90 mm |
Shape | Round (Ball insert) |
Technique | Milled |
Orientation | Medal alignment ↑↑ |

Reverse
Stylised player heading the ball.
Script: Latin
Lettering:
EURO2016
FRANCE
Edge
Plain
Comment
The football is a gold-plated silver ball.Interesting fact
One interesting fact about this coin is that it features a unique design that incorporates a gold-plated ball, which is a nod to the UEFA European Football Championship, also known as Euro 2016, that took place in France that year. The coin's design was created by the French artist, Joaquin Jimenez, and it showcases a stylized image of a football player heading the ball, with the gold-plated ball being the focal point of the design.
